sacral plexus Flashcards
what is the spinal root value of the sacral plexus
anterior fibres of S1-S4
what nerves originate from the sacral plexus
superior gluteal inferior gluteal sciatic posterior femoral cutaneous pudendal nerve
what muscle does the sacral plexus sit on
piriformis
what foramen do most of the nerves pass through
greater sciatic
root value of superior gluteal nerve
L4-S1
what muscles does the superior gluteal nerve innervate
gluteus minimus
gluteus medius
tensor fascia lata
what is the root value for the inferior gluteal nerve
L5-S2
what muscle does the inferior gluteal nerve innervate
gluteus maximus
what is the root value for the sciatic nerve
L4-S3
what muscles does the sciatic nerve innervate
all muscles in posterior compartment of thigh, leg and sole of foot
what areas of skin does the sciatic nerve supply
tibial branch - posterolateral leg, lateral foot, sole of foot
common fibular - lateral leg, dorsum of foot
what is the root value of the posterior femoral cutaneous nerve
S1-S3
what area of skin does the posterior femoral cutaneous nerve innervate
posterior surface of thigh and leg
perineal branch innervates most skin of perineum
root value of pudendal nerve
S2-S4
what muscles does the pudendal nerve innervate
skeletal muscles in perineum
external anal sphincter
external urethral sphincter
levator ani
what area of skin does the pudendal nerve innervate
penis
clitoris
skin around anus
anal canal
what foramina does the pudendal nerve pass through
greater sciatic foramen
lesser sciatic foramen
what ligament does the pudendal nerve cross to go from the greater to lesser sciatic foramen
sacrospinous ligament
what forms the pudendal canal
the fascia of the obturator internus
where is the pudendal canal
inner aspect of ischium
below obturator foramen
moves posterior to anterior
what are the contents of the pudendal canal
internal pudendal artery and veins
pudendal nerve
what branches does the pudendal nerve give off in the pudendal canal
inferior rectal
perineal nerve
what does the pudendal nerve continue as in the pudendal canal
dorsal nerve of penis or clitoris
what muscles does the perineal nerve inervate
levator ani muscles
bulbospongiosus
ischiocavernosus
what does the dorsal nerve innervate
skin of penis or clitoris
what anatomical pathway does the pudendal nerve take
goes through greater sciatic foramen anterior to piriformis
follows ischial spine to enter pelvis again through the lesser sciatic foramen and supplies the perineum
describe the anatomical pathway of the superior gluteal nerve
passes through greater sciatic foramen over piriformis to supply gluteus medius and minimus
describe the anatomical pathway of the inferior gluteal nerve
passes under piriformis through greater sciatic foramen to supply gluteus maximus
